Travelling from Ghaziabad will become easier as Sahibabad to Duhai could soon be reached in just 12 minutes, a 20 km distance that currently takes more than 35 minutes to travel by road, thanks to Rapid Rail project. Next week, the RAPIDX line, India’s first Rapid Rail line, is set to be operational.
Sahibabad, Ghaziabad, Guldhar, Duhai, and Duhai Depot are the five stations that make up this section, which spans a distance of 17 km. Ten trains will run along the route, with each rapid rail able to carry up to 1,700 passengers. The project consists of 12 km of underground track (Delhi: 4.08 km; UP: 8.08 km) and 70 km of elevated track (9.22 km in Delhi; 60.57 km in Uttar Pradesh).
Yogi Adityanath, the chief minister of Uttar Pradesh, will travel to Ghaziabad to inspect the Sahibabad RAPIDX station, where NCRTC representatives will give a overview of RAPIDX’s operations.
Recently, the station was visited by local officials, senior NCRTC officials, and General VK Singh (retired), the Member of Parliament for Ghaziabad and Minister of State for Road Transport & Highways. The RRTS priority section will be the first railway system in the nation to run the entirety of its length at a top speed of 160 kmph, promising commuters quick, secure and comfortable regional transit services.
